Nice video! Any tips on handling vertical combat like if the players and enemies have the fly spell?
@encountersmith
@encountersmith Жыл бұрын
Great question! I usually put the little wings icon on the token very similarly to the colored dots. Then in the 3 circles that pop up above the token when you click on it, I usually will keep track of how high they are off the ground in the blue circle. But you could go about it in a few ways.
